Archives in a changing climate: proposing new “solutions” for a new era

Abstract
The International Conference on the History of Records and Archives (I-CHORA) has been held since 2003 as a periodic conference aimed at encouraging and promoting interdisciplinary research into the history of records, recordkeeping practices and recordkeeping institutions.Conferences to date have taken place in Toronto (2003), Amsterdam (2005 and2015), Boston (2007), Perth (2008), London (2010) and Austin (2012), each attracting between 100 and 130 scholars and professionals from around the world (Foscarini et al. 2016, pp.xi-v).The eighth iteration, I-CHORA 8, was held at Monash University in Melbourne on 28-30 May 2018.The theme of the conference was "Archives in a Changing Climate" (http://ichor a.org/).Participants discussed the multiplicity of historical contexts in which archives are created, transmitted, preserved and reactivated, and the fast pace of change to which contemporary recordkeepers have to adjust to keep up with new technologies and new expectations.In the first of two special issues of Archival Science dedicated to papers from I-CHORA 8, we present four articles that propose new "solutions", or better, aspirations, for a new era in archives and recordkeeping.The first contribution by Jessica Lapp suggests a way of rethinking the role played by archivists, whereas the other three articles, by Cate O'Neill, Viviane Frings-Hessami, and Sue McKemmish, Tom Chandler and Shannon Faulkhead, offer ways of reframing recordkeeping practices that focus on the rights of the subjects of the records.
